								<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Comic writer Frank Miller has some strong opinions on Batman. The work Frank Miller did with &#8220;The Dark Knight Returns&#8221; is considered by many to be iconic, and it&#8217;s no big secret that Zack Snyder has said Miller&#8217;s work had a big influence on him.</p>
<p>Frank Miller recently spoke to <a href="http://variety.com/2016/film/festivals/lucca-comics-frank-miller-on-where-he-would-take-the-batman-movie-franchise-1201904240/" target="_blank">Variety</a> about what he would do with a Batman movie if he had the chance, and Miller noted that he would make it smaller.</p>
<p>&#8220;My dream would be to make it much smaller. To lose the toys and to focus more on the mission, and to use the city a great deal more. Because he’s got a loving relationship with the city he’s protecting. And unlike Superman his connection to crime is intimate; it has been ever since his parents were murdered. And he defeats criminals with his hands. So it would be a different take. But it will never be in my hands, because it would not be a good place to make toys from. There wouldn’t be a line of toys.&#8221;</p>
<p>As for his opinion on &#8220;Batman V Superman: Dawn of Justice&#8221; Miller offered a simple statement.</p>
<p>&#8220;I’ll just say: ‘Thanks.’ What can I say? — he laughs — no, actually I’ll withdraw that; I’ll say: ‘You’re welcome!’&#8221;</p>

								<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>&#8220;The Dark Knight&#8221; trilogy was made up of three exciting Batman films each of which had a lengthy run time. But the folks over at Burger Fiction have condensed the entire trilogy into one 90 second clip.</p>
<p>The clip covers everything from Batman&#8217;s origin in &#8220;Batman Begins,&#8221; to his supposed death at the end of &#8220;The Dark Knight Rises.&#8221; If you&#8217;ve seen the movies before then you&#8217;ll probably appreciate this quick refresher, but if you&#8217;ve never seen the films before then you&#8217;re going to want to pay close attention because &#8220;quick&#8221; is the key word here.</p>
<p>You can relive &#8220;The Dark Knight&#8221; trilogy and all of Christian Bale&#8217;s Batman voice glory via the clip below.</p>
